If anyone at Sony/Guerrilla is reading, let me introduce you to this thing called a currency converter. It allows you to work out fair prices for your products. Revolutionary, I know.

US price: $39.99
UK converted price: $39.99 = £25.09 + 20% VAT = £30.11 (not £40.81, in fact nowhere near).
EU converted price: $39.99 = €31.65 + 20%? tax (I actually think tax is lower than this in some countries, but I'm not sure) = €39.64 (not €49.99).

So where do the extra £10/€10 come from?

Its truly perplexing to me when a HD re-release isn't 60fps. Is that a major engine overhaul? I always think of it like new computer hardware and assume that should be relatively simple but I must be wrong.
Your assumption would be wrong. Console games are designed for a very specific platform and some of the techniques used in their creation may not be compatible with certain changes.

Bumping up the framerate to 60 fps could actually break a number of game systems and result in other visual problems. None of us know for sure but it's not unlikely.

Yeah thats what I assumed. Unfortunate. I wonder if any dev's outside of ND built their engines to scale relatively painless with new hardware.

Are you referring to Naughty Dog? If so, you should really look into the horrors the Jak & Daxter Collection team had to go through.

They actually used the PS2's PSone emulation chip as a sound decoder with the original Jak... things like that make for a pain to port.
